Secure Your Screen: The Ultimate Spin Bike Tablet Holder Guide

Whether you're streaming spin classes or tracking metrics, a reliable tablet holder for your exercise bike is non-negotiable. This guide focuses on the versatile C-clamp design, which fits handlebars, treadmill consoles, and even microphone stands, accommodating devices from 4.7 to 13.5 inches.

Key Considerations Before Buying

  • Check your bike's handlebar diameter: Most C-clamps fit 0.5 to 2 inches, but always measure to ensure a snug fit without damaging the frame.
  • Consider the weight of your tablet: While this holder supports up to 13.5-inch devices, heavier tablets may require extra tightening to prevent slippage during vigorous workouts.
  • Look for 360° rotation: This feature allows you to switch between portrait and landscape orientation seamlessly, making it ideal for following workout apps or watching videos.

What Our Analysts Recommend

Quality indicators include a sturdy clamp with rubber padding to protect your equipment, a secure locking mechanism that won't loosen with vibration, and a ball-joint system that holds its position without drooping. Also, verify that the holder's grip expands to fit your specific device thickness, even with a case.

Common Issues

Common complaints include clamps that slip or break under pressure, insufficient padding that scratches handlebars, and holders that can't maintain a firm grip on larger tablets, leading to dangerous falls during intense sessions.

Quality Indicators

High-quality holders typically feature reinforced ABS plastic, metal ball joints, and dual-locking mechanisms. Look for products with a high rating (above 4.5) and a substantial number of reviews, as this indicates real-world reliability. Also, consider the seller's warranty and customer service reputation.
